css 知识体系
CSS(层叠样式表)是一种用于描述HTML或XML(包括如SVG,MathML等衍生技术)文档样式的样式表语言。CSS知识体系涵盖了以下内容:
1. 基础语法和选择器:这是理解CSS如何工作的重要基础。基本的语法,如属性和值的格式,以及如何使用选择器来选择和样式化HTML元素,都是需要掌握的基本概念。
2. 盒模型:盒模型是CSS布局的基础,它包括内容、内边距、边框和外边距四个部分。理解盒模型如何工作是掌握CSS的关键。
3. 布局和定位:包括相对定位、绝对定位、固定定位等,以及如何使用这些技术来控制页面元素的布局和位置。
4. 颜和背景:理解颜和背景的基本概念,包括如何使用不同的颜模式(如RGB、HEX、HSL等),以及如何设置背景颜、背景图像等。
5. 字体和文本:如何设置字体、字体大小、字体样式、行高等。还包括如何处理文本,如文本对齐、文本装饰等。
6. 动画和过渡:理解如何使用CSS创建动画和过渡效果,包括关键帧动画、过渡效果等。
7. 响应式设计:这是一种使网站在各种设备和屏幕大小上看起来都很好的方法。它涉及到媒体查询、视口元数据等概念。
8. CSS预处理器:如Sass或Less,它们提供了一些功能,如变量、混合、函数等,可以增强CSS的功能。
9. CSS框架:如Bootstrap或Foundation,它们提供了一套预先设计好的CSS类和组件,可以帮助更快地构建响应式网站。
10. 性能优化:了解如何优化CSS以提高网站性能,包括减少文件大小、避免不必要的重绘和回流等。
svg图片怎么使用以上就是CSS知识体系的主要内容,希望对你有所帮助。
版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系QQ:729038198,我们将在24小时内删除。
发表评论